How Our Toilet Overflow Water Removal Service Works
When you call us for toilet overflow water removal, our team springs into action. Here’s what you can expect:
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ll arrive at your property, assess the damage, and create a customized plan to get your home dry and safe. Our technicians will identify the source of the overflow, evaluate the extent of the damage, and find out the best course of action. This step typically takes 30-60 minutes, depending on the complexity of the situation.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using our powerful water extraction equipment, we’ll remove as much water as possible from your property.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old growth. Our technicians will work efficiently to extract water from walls, floors, and ceilings, usually within 2-4 hours.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, we’ll use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your property. This step is critical in preventing mold growth and ensuring your home is safe and healthy. Our technicians will monitor the drying process closely, typically taking 3-5 days to complete.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
After the drying process is complete, we’ll thoroughly clean and sanitize your property to remove any remaining bacteria, viruses, or other contaminants. This step is essential in preventing the spread of germs and keeping your home healthy. Our technicians will use eco-friendly cleaning products and equipment to ensure a safe and healthy environment.
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ction
Finally, we’ll work with you to restore and reconstruct any damaged areas, including walls, floors, and ceilings. Our team will ensure that your home is rebuilt to its original condition, using high-quality materials and craftsmanship. This step typically takes 3-7 days, depending on the extent of the damage.

Toilet Overflow Water Removal Cost in Newland, NC
The cost of toilet overflow water removal in Newland, NC can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here’s a rough estimate of what you might expect: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, complexity of damage |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, complexity of damage |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, complexity of damage |
| Restoration and Re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, complexity of damage, materials used |
| Emergency Service Fee | $100 – $500 | Time of day, urgency of situation |
Keep in mind that these are rough estimates, and the actual cost of toilet overflow water removal in Newland, NC may vary depending on your specific situation. We offer free estimates and on-site assessments to give you a more accurate quote.

Q: How do I prevent toilet overflow water damage in the future?
A: To prevent toilet overflow water damage, make sure to regularly check and clean your toilet, including the flapper, fill valve, and overflow tube. Also, consider installing a toilet overflow prevention device, which can help prevent water from flowing over the toilet bowl.
